s

게시판 글작성시 일부 태그막기

<script>
//-------------------------------------------------------------------------->

// 태그 미리 정의해둔후 본문에 사용되면 리턴 시킴.
// form 강제 서브밋 하면 내부 페이지에서 차단..
var f=document.form;
if(f.html.value != 1) {
var exceptTag = "form,meta,script"; //사용불가능 태그 정의
var s = ",";
var ArrayOfTag = exceptTag.split(s);

for (i=0;i<ArrayOfTag.length;i++) {

Tag = '<' + ArrayOfTag[i];

title = f.title.value;
content = f.content.value;

content =content.replace(' ','');
title =title.replace(' ','');

chk1 = title.search(Tag); //title 에 위정의한 태그값이 없으면 -1 리턴..
chk2 = content.search(Tag);

if(chk1 != -1) {
alert("해당 tag (form,iframe,meta,script)는 사용하실 수 없습니다.");
f.title.focus();return;
}

if(chk2 != -1) {
alert("해당 tag (form,iframe,meta,script)는 사용하실 수 없습니다.");
f.content.focus();return;
}

}
}
//-------------------------------------------------------------------------->
< /script>
오늘 하다가 올려봅니다..
별거 아니지만 게시판에 악성태그 쓰는거 막을수 있을거 같아서..
PHP로 하면 쉽기는 한데..
체크한담에 history.back() 하니까 입력한 자료가 다 날라가서..
스크립트로 처리하는거 고민하다가 해봤습니다..

허접한팁.
|

댓글 1개

댓글을 작성하시려면 로그인이 필요합니다.

프로그램

+
제목 글쓴이 날짜 조회
12년 전 조회 5,311
12년 전 조회 2,382
12년 전 조회 2,562
12년 전 조회 6,386
12년 전 조회 4,096
12년 전 조회 3,055
12년 전 조회 2,203
12년 전 조회 4,392
12년 전 조회 3,387
12년 전 조회 3,071
12년 전 조회 2,743
12년 전 조회 2,425
12년 전 조회 2,448
12년 전 조회 2,191
12년 전 조회 3,269
12년 전 조회 2,581
12년 전 조회 2,266
12년 전 조회 3,337
12년 전 조회 2,520
12년 전 조회 3,118
12년 전 조회 4,319
12년 전 조회 2,080
12년 전 조회 3,076
12년 전 조회 1,924
12년 전 조회 2,398
12년 전 조회 3,044
12년 전 조회 2,662
12년 전 조회 5,457
13년 전 조회 3,586
13년 전 조회 3,761
13년 전 조회 2,140
13년 전 조회 9,448
13년 전 조회 4,260
13년 전 조회 2,328
13년 전 조회 2,183
13년 전 조회 3,620
13년 전 조회 6,311
13년 전 조회 4,330
13년 전 조회 2,237
13년 전 조회 1.4만
13년 전 조회 2,122
13년 전 조회 1,522
13년 전 조회 4,798
13년 전 조회 2,301
13년 전 조회 1만
13년 전 조회 1,710
13년 전 조회 2,055
13년 전 조회 4,177
13년 전 조회 1,803
13년 전 조회 2,683
13년 전 조회 4,667
13년 전 조회 1,989
13년 전 조회 1,884
13년 전 조회 6,256
13년 전 조회 2,380
13년 전 조회 1,709
13년 전 조회 3,422
13년 전 조회 3,444
13년 전 조회 2,419
13년 전 조회 3,842
13년 전 조회 7,525
13년 전 조회 3,096
13년 전 조회 1,664
13년 전 조회 2,821
13년 전 조회 2,783
13년 전 조회 3,529
13년 전 조회 1,511
13년 전 조회 2,601
13년 전 조회 1,577
13년 전 조회 2,715
13년 전 조회 3,595
13년 전 조회 2,058
13년 전 조회 4,783
13년 전 조회 1.1만
13년 전 조회 2,057
13년 전 조회 3,445
13년 전 조회 3,041
13년 전 조회 3,875
13년 전 조회 6,977
13년 전 조회 3,529
13년 전 조회 3,941
13년 전 조회 1,926
13년 전 조회 1,681
13년 전 조회 2,789
13년 전 조회 6,786
13년 전 조회 2,408
13년 전 조회 5,631
13년 전 조회 1,725
13년 전 조회 5,028
13년 전 조회 2,204
13년 전 조회 2,016
13년 전 조회 2,468
13년 전 조회 2,225
13년 전 조회 1,452
13년 전 조회 1,442
13년 전 조회 2.1만
13년 전 조회 1,414
13년 전 조회 1,987
13년 전 조회 2,015
13년 전 조회 2,245